Model Risk Management (MRM) is a function reporting directly to the Group Chief Risk Officer and responsible for the identification, assessment, monitoring and management of Model risk within Barclays. Independent Validation Unit (IVU) is one of the key areas under MRM. As a second line defence function, IVU approves or rejects models following a technical review thereby ensuring transparency and effective management of risk associated with any model in which Barclays relies upon for financial or non-financial decisions. The IVU Team has responsibility for the Independent Validation of various model types (e.g. capital, impairment, underwriting, behaviour, collection & recovery, existing customer management (ECM), fraud, stress testing models etc.). It provides assurances to the senior managers including the individual Business Chief Risk Officers and the Group CRO and Finance Director (through the Executive Models Committee) on the key aspects associated with risk models.
